Introduction
In this lesson, we solve problems involving percent equations. Percent problems can be reduced to equations and the unknown quantity is found by solving that equation
Consider the following example problems
Example 1
125% of 50.8 is what number?
Solution
Step 1:
In this problem, the words of, is, and what translate to a multiplication sign ×, an equal to sign = and an unknown variable x.
Step 2:
The problem is re-written as 125% of 50.8 = x
This reduces to percent equation 125% × 50.8 = x
or 1.25 × 50.8 = x
Step 3:
Solving for x, x = 1.25×50.8 = 63.5
So, 125% of 50.8 is 63.5

Example 3
What is 90% of 218?
Solution
Step 1:
In this problem, the words of, is, and what translate to a multiplication sign × and an equal to sign = and an unknown variable x.
Step 2:
The problem is re-written as 90% of 218 = x
This is reduced to percent equation 90% × 218 = x
or 0.90 × 218 = x
Step 3:
Solving for x, x = 0.90×218 = 196.2
So, 90% of 218 is 196.2
